Understanding the Foreign Limited Partnership, Annual Report for Limited Partnership 2022 in Arkansas:

The Foreign Limited Partnership, Annual Report for Limited Partnership 2022 in Arkansas is a mandatory filing required by the state to track and monitor the activities of foreign partnerships operating within its jurisdiction. By submitting this report, businesses provide essential information to the state government, ensuring transparency and accountability in their operations.

Who Needs to File the Foreign Limited Partnership, Annual Report for Limited Partnership 2022?

All foreign limited partnerships conducting business in Arkansas are required to file the Annual Report. This includes partnerships that have not yet commenced operations or those that have made no changes during the reporting period. It is essential to comply with this requirement to avoid penalties and maintain good standing.

Why Filing Matters for Business Compliance:

Failure to file the Annual Report can have serious implications for your business, including losing limited liability protection, facing fines, or even being dissolved by the state. Maintaining compliance with state regulations is essential for the long-term success and sustainability of your business.
